
INCLUSIVE FUN
Recreation Inclusion is an important option & choice for meeting the leisure needs of individuals with disabilities. Inclusion provides a person with a disability the opportunity to be included or “mainstreamed” in playgrounds or recreation department programs as they participate alongside their non-disabled peers.
The P&R Staff works closely with the participant & family to provide an enriching recreation experience in the least restrictive environment.
The Riverview Parks & Recreation Department strives for each participant to function at his / her highest level of ability. Benefits of participation include increased socialization & community awareness, development of new leisure skills, increased emotional wellbeing, increased self-esteem, all in a fun, safe and structured recreation environment.

- This is a semi-structured program that enables all children (Gr. K and Up) with Special needs in the community to become involved in recreation and playground activities, such as, swimming, crafts, singsongs, passive games, outings & special events.
- The program will focus on increased socialization & community awareness, development of new leisure skills, increased emotional wellbeing, and increased self-esteem. All in a fun and safe environment.
- This summer program is Free of charge and based on a drop-in system. Due to limiting staff numbers, we cannot facilitate one-on-one interaction at all times, however, we more than welcome support workers.
